What does a typical day look like for a live in no experience?

As a Live-In (No Experience) staff member, your day usually starts by assisting with basic household tasks such as cleaning, laundry, or simple meal preparation. You may also help with running errands, providing companionship, or supporting family members with their daily routines. The role often involves flexible hours, as you share living space with your employer and are expected to be available when needed. While initial responsibilities may be simple, there's potential to take on more variety and responsibility as you gain experience and trust within the household.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the live in no experience position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Live-In (No Experience) caregiver or domestic helper, key skills include reliability, a willingness to learn, and basic organizational abilities, with no formal qualifications typically required. While technical tools or certifications are not mandatory for entry-level positions, familiarity with household appliances and basic first aid can be advantageous. Strong soft skills such as patience, clear communication, and empathy help build trust with employers and households. These skills ensure you can adapt quickly, provide responsible support, and create a positive living environment.

Position Details

You support people with intellectual and developmental disabilities to live their best lives as independently as possible. Your support is needed in many areas of daily living including:

  • Participating in fun activities
  • Budgeting
  • Meal preparation
  • Help the individuals try new things.
  • Shopping
  • Mentor the individuals to learn new skills

Qualifications and Skills

  • No experience needed.
  • Must be at least 18 years old
  • Must be able to pass a drug test and a background check

 Experience working with people with developmental disabilities is a plus, but we're willing to train you.
